Variation in Susceptibility to Permethrin in Culex pipiens and Culex restuans Populations in the Great Lakes Region of the United States.

出版信息

J Am Mosq Control Assoc. 2022 Sep 1;38(3):188-197. doi: 10.2987/22-7062.

DOI:10.2987/22-7062
PMID:35901310
Abstract

Two Culex pipiens form Pipiens colony strains and a field population of Cx. restuans from Michigan were susceptible and a Cx. pipiens form Molestus colony strain was comparatively less susceptible to a dose of 43 μg/ml of permethrin in Centers for Disease Control and Prevention (CDC) bottle bioassays. Using this diagnostic dose and these populations as controls, adult female Cx. pipiens and Cx. restuans were reared from egg rafts from 28 sites in Illinois, Ohio, Michigan, Iowa, Indiana, Wisconsin, and Minnesota. Tested mosquitoes showed high mortality in populations from 12 sites, less mortality (90-96%) at 9 sites, and less than 90% mortality from 7 sites during 30-min exposures. However, all tested populations showed 97-100% mortality at 60 min, indicating low phenotypic penetrance of resistance factors. These results indicate variation in susceptibility to permethrin in populations of West Nile virus vectors in the Great Lakes region of the United States, with evidence of modest resistance at 7 of 28 (25%) of the sampled populations.
